Title
Swearing in of George M. Low as Deputy Administrator of NASA
Full Description
Swearing in of George M. Low as Deputy Administrator of NASA. The 43-year-old
veteran of NASAs Mercury, Gemini, and Apollo manned flight programs was
administered the oath of Office by Dr. Thomas O. Paine, NASA's Administrator.
President Nixon nominated Low for the post November 13, 1969, and the Senate
confirmed him on November 26, 1969. Low, who joined the National Advisory
Committee for Aeronautics (NASAs predecessor agency) in 1949, was the
fourth person to hold the Deputy Administrator post at NASA.
